Convert joule/second to pound-foot/minute

Please provide values below to convert joule/second [J/s] to pound-foot/minute [lbf*ft/min], or Convert pound-foot/minute to joule/second.

1 J/s = 44.2537403261 lbf*ft/min. To convert joule/second to pound-foot/minute, multiply the value by 44.2537403261; to go the other way, divide by it (1 lbf*ft/min = 0.02259696 J/s). How to Convert Joule/second to Pound-Foot/minute

1 J/s = 44.2537403261324 lbf*ft/min

Example: convert 15 J/s to lbf*ft/min:
15 J/s = 15 × 44.2537403261324 lbf*ft/min = 663.806104891985 lbf*ft/min

Joule/second

The joule per second (J/s) is a unit of power representing the rate at which energy is transferred or converted, equivalent to one watt.

History/Origin

The joule per second has been used as a measure of power since the adoption of the SI system, where the watt (W) became the standard unit of power, with 1 J/s = 1 W.

Current Use

J/s is primarily used in scientific and engineering contexts to quantify power, especially in physics and electrical engineering, often interchangeably with watts.


Pound-Foot/minute

Pound-foot per minute (lbf·ft/min) is a unit of power representing the rate at which work is done or energy is transferred, specifically the amount of work in pound-feet performed per minute.

History/Origin

The pound-foot per minute has been used historically in engineering and mechanical contexts to measure power, especially in systems where imperial units are prevalent. It is derived from the foot-pound unit of work, divided by time in minutes, aligning with traditional British engineering practices.

Current Use

Today, pound-foot per minute is primarily used in specific engineering fields, such as mechanical and automotive industries, to measure torque-related power outputs, though it is less common than SI units like watts or horsepower.
